The role of a medical receptionist is often referred to as a "care navigator" and that is exactly what we need now. Experience in this role would be useful but not vital since we would provide the training you need to be able to deliver a great service to our patients.

If you enjoy helping people and listening to them with the intention of trying to figure out how you can help them to access the services they need, then this role is for you. This means that you are not only supporting our patients, but our large clinical team too. You will need to feel comfortable with technology, and also with change since the NHS is required to constantly change to meet the emerging needs of our population.

Main duties of the job

The role of a care navigator is essentially a customer service role. Our patients need to access our services, but they do not always understand how wide ranging the skills are within our team. The successful candidate must have strong IT skills and be happy to learn how to use our clinical software, and have a confident telephone manner and good, face to face interpersonal skills.

It would be your main task to meet their needs in the most efficient manner which often includes directing them to any of the excellent community services available to us all in Burnley and the surrounding area. Some of the time we are unable to offer exactly what a patient wants, exactly when they want it, but it is the way in which you communicate what we can offer which will make you a good care navigator.

Disclosure and Barring Service Check

This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.
